Warner Bros. TV will be at SDCC 2018 in a number of forms, and Supernatural is one of them. Check out the latest promo for the event with the Supernatural yearbook.

Supernatural is one of many Warner Bros. TV shows making its way to SDCC 2018. We’ve already seen some of the ways Warner Bros. and companies have teamed up for the epic convention of the year. Well, now the company is doing something by itself. It’s all about yearbooks, and the Supernatural yearbook is the last on the list.

The creative juices of the marketing team have certainly been flowing this year. Each yearbook took photos of the stars of the shows–those who are attending the convention with their panels–and stuck them together to create the Comic-Con Class of 2018. Of course, there’s a twist. All the photos are those from when the actors and actresses were children.

We’ve seen Jared Padalecki and Jensen Ackles’ younger shots in the past, but what about Misha Collins and Alexander Calvert? Now you’ll get a chance to see just how adorable baby Jack is and how quirky Castiel has always been.

While they’re the only four on the Supernatural yearbook, there are other SPN guest stars on their own yearbooks from Warner Bros. TV. In fact, Jack’s mom, Kelly–better known in real life as Courtney Ford–is in the Legends of Tomorrow yearbook. After being killed off during Jack’s birth, Kelly was whisked into the Arrowverse, where she now plays host to a demon. Hmm, small world!

Despite Arrow also making its way to SDCC 2018, there isn’t a yearbook photo of the show. That’s a shame because Katie Cassidy is on the series now.

It’s all about the countdown to SDCC 2018 now. Supernatural‘s panel will be one of the last of the whole event on Sunday morning, but is one of just two CW shows making its way to Hall H. This is going to be an exciting time to learn more about Supernatural Season 14.
